    Quick question... Doens't the 458 come with the VIP (factory) book that all Ferraris use to come with??

    Didnt get mine...
     
  2. dan360

    dan360 F1 Rookie

    Feb 18, 2003
    2,669
    Boston
    They seem to have stopped doing them in favor of the little model, I got the VIP book for 599, Scud, 16M, but not the cars that came before them, and not for the 458 or GTO.
